Item description:
Ceramic cast sculpture, made with kaolin, also known as "soft porcelain," glazed, vitrified, and hand-decorated with an airbrush. It depicts a beautiful lady with a hat in her hand, in the Art Nouveau style. It is unsigned, but the catalog number is present. The sculpture dates back to the early decades of the 20th century, between 1900 and 1930. The piece is unsigned, but its style and, especially, its coloration suggest the Austrian Amphora factory, whose color is the pale blue. This beautiful lady, with soft, diaphanous tones and a hat over her dress, is very reminiscent of the ladies by Michael Powolny for Wiener Keramik or Emil Meier for Goldscheider. Information on artist and/or manufacturer:
The Amphora factory was founded in 1892 in the town of Turn-Teplitz, Bohemia, by Riessner, Stellmacher, and Kessel. It specializes in the production of figurines and artistic vases. It boasts numerous auction results and is internationally renowned for the quality of its artistic production.
